In a study of professors, women got 378 new work requests over 4 wks vs 118 for men. Women spent more time on service, advising & teaching; men on research. Orgs should track who is taking extra duties & ensure they are rewarded and distributed fairly. forbes.com/sites/kimelses…

This AM: Per vendor of @US_FDA-cleared device with VERY outdated software: 1) FDA approval severely slows necessary upgrades in US vs. non-US market 2) can't patch components because components affecting test system incompatible with patches. @AMPath @AMIAinformatics @pathbytes
